Webster Memorial Building

The Webster Memorial Building is a historic house at 36 Trumbull Street in downtown . Built in 1870 and extensively restyled in 1924, it is a rare example of Georgian Revival architecture in the downtown area, noted for its historical association with the Family Services Society, a prominent local charity.
